H Street Festival is one of the most anticipated and highly attended single day festivals in Washington D.C.  The festival is 11 blocks long and has 14 staging areas that are diversely themed and programmed to target the different segments of audiences.  The staging areas feature music of different genres, dance, youth based performances, interactive children’s program, fashion, heritage arts, poetry and many more.

The festival started as a 500 participant bloc party more than 12 years ago, it has now grown into a 150,000 participant event.  The change is immense and the impact is lasting. By using the arts as a principle motivator of the festival, it has proven the arts can be a valuable agent in impacting economic growth.  The festival also has a direct impact on reducing commercial building vacancy rate on H Street Corridor from 75% to under 5%.  H Street Festival has successfully utilized arts as an engine for the growth for the historic neighborhood.
